Output d30bb308038a754ca7eff287cbed4e09d92fdd6ca511bc22c3e32931f1d79e85:1

value
20099088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5815b1e59cc8d9f48f45ed99ff093d31350ba51 OP_EQUAL
address
3KhL19C99bayXbwGMGVyxT36F6CAtDRkUX
transaction
d30bb308038a754ca7eff287cbed4e09d92fdd6ca511bc22c3e32931f1d79e85
confirmations
302372
spent
true